Output 765164aec70dd127653c1c917396fd6be5a660b436c10921a426e2380b42ff4d:1

value
27383748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3751f8154692be7711b6c846f72ee9181df6b OP_EQUAL
address
3BMEXQkx3FNLejZNHXcbX1rtbAS2RGmGQr
transaction
765164aec70dd127653c1c917396fd6be5a660b436c10921a426e2380b42ff4d
spent
true